Arbiter (State Specific Attorney) 250519 (Remote)

Join to apply for the Arbiter (State Specific Attorney) 250519 (Remote) role at Capitol Bridge.

About Capitol Bridge: Founded in 2012, Capitol Bridge is based in Arlington, Virginia, specializing in independent medical reviews, records/data management, medical coding, administrative staffing, and eligibility reviews.

Job Overview: We seek a highly skilled and detail-oriented Arbiter to arbitrate/decide payment disputes, analyze documentation, and manage case files. The ideal candidate has strong Microsoft skills, excellent writing abilities, and keen attention to detail.

Location: Remote (preferably CST or EST zones)

Pay & Benefits: Base salary $70,000-$90,000 based on experience, with medical, dental, vision, 401(k) with match, paid holidays and vacation.

Responsibilities:

  1. Arbitrate and decide payment disputes.
  2. Remain neutral, analyze materials, and write concise determinations within deadlines.
  3. Review cases, summarize facts, and assess issues.
  4. Research federal law, regulations, and contract law.
  5. Communicate determinations clearly.
  6. Exercise independent judgment for accurate, supported decisions.
  7. Manage complex case files and perform other duties as assigned.
  8. Draft and review payment decisions and email responses.
  9. Interpret regulations and policies to formulate recommendations.

Qualifications & Experience:

  • Juris Doctorate preferred.
  • 3+ years relevant professional experience.
  • Experience arbitrating/disputing in the medical field.
  • Ability to work in fast-paced environments.
  • Strong organizational, communication, and teamwork skills.
  • Proficiency with SharePoint, Salesforce, Microsoft Office.
